The Summer Tournaments are conducted between
late May and early August, depending on the school year.
Members may play in as many events as they wish
during the Summer Series. Points
are awarded to the Top 19 finishers in each age group. These
points are averaged at the conclusion of the summer and are a part of the criteria
for qualifying for season-ending Championships (Club Championship,
9-Hole
Classic and Grand Championship).
The Summer Tournaments are scheduled during the
week at golf courses all over the metro Atlanta area. Tee times
generally run between 7:30 a.m. and 11:00 a.m. (note: this varies
from course to course).

Player of the Year (POY) points are accumulated throughout
the Summer Series based on performance in each daily event.
These points are then used to calculate a POY points average. A
player's POY points average is calculated by considering the
average points earned in five Summer Series tournaments. The total points
earned during the junior's best five Summer Series events are
divided by five (total points earned/five) to determine the player’s POY
points average.
Should a junior participate in fewer than five events, his/her
point total will still be divided by five (it is important to
note that a minimum of five events are required in order to be
eligible to qualify for season-ending championships). If a
player participates in more than five events, his/her best five
events (most points earned) will be used to determine the POY
points average.
Tournament Selection (Minimum and Maximum Events)
Summer Series tournament selection opens each year in mid-March. Juniors will be notified via email when
they are cleared to register for events. Those players with the
most seniority (determined by the year the junior first joined)
will have the opportunity to select courses first. Do not
attempt to register for tournaments until you have been directed
to do so by the Atlanta Junior Golf staff. For the initial
registration period (mid-March through mid-May), juniors in all divisions will be
limited to a maximum of six tournaments. Just before the Summer
Series begins, all remaining tee times in events will be
available for players on a first come, first served basis. There is no maximum number of events in
which a player may participate. As long as the junior registers
in his/her age group, he/she may play in as many tournaments as
space allows.
In order to qualify for season ending-championships (Club Championship,
9-Hole Classic and
Grand Championship) juniors in all
age divisions must participate in at least five events
